Age limits There's no upper age limit on volunteering. Some organisations' insurance policies do not cover you if you're under 16 or over a certain age. You cannot work for a profit-making organisation if you're under 14, even if you're not paid.
Under what circumstances can foreign citizens volunteer to enlist and serve in the IDF? IDF recruitment of foreign citizens is possible via the Volunteers from Abroad (Mahal) track for Jews living abroad. Foreign citizens who are not Jewish may volunteer in non-military framework.
If you are planning to volunteer in Israel for more than 3 months you need to apply for a volunteer visa. The volunteer organization of your choice will need to apply for this visa for you. Please contact your project coordinator to arrange the visa procedure.

The European Solidarity Corps (ESC), known until 2016 as European Voluntary Service (EVS), is an international volunteering program by the European Commission for young people to go individually or in teams to another country, usually from one European country to another, to work for a non-profit cause.
The European Solidarity Corps is a funding programme of the European Union that creates opportunities for young people to volunteer and run their own solidarity projects that benefit communities around Europe.
